E-Sports is Now An Official Sport in Pakistan: Fawad Hussain

The Federal Minister of Science and Technology Chaudhry Fawad Hussain has made an exciting new announcement for gamers. From now on, E-Sports will be considered an official sport in Pakistan, akin to many other countries.

He announced the move on Twitter, where he revealed that the decision came after a discussion between the Pakistan Sports Board and the Pakistan Science Foundation. He also told gamers to get ready as new opportunities will be coming their way soon.

Following this decision, we expect to see games like PUBG and PUBG Mobile flourish in the local gaming scene like never before. Tekken, CSGO, and Dota 2 are also some of the popular names in Pakistan, which are more than likely to thrive once the E-Sports market starts getting more traction.
